I'm 6 weeks into a fishless cycle. I started dosing with 4ppm ammonia and within 2 weeks this began to drop, shortly after nitrites appeared and not long after nitrates appeared. 4 weeks later and nitrites are off the chart high, nitrates are about 40ppm. The nitrites have been off chart for a couple of weeks. I can now dose with 4ppm ammonia and it drops to 0ppm in less than 24 hours so that part of the cycle is well established.
I have been adding a small amount of ammonia everyday to feed the bacteria, is this the right thing to do? I thought the nitrites should be dropping by now.
Should I do a water change? Do I just need to be more patient, lol?
Oh... 10 gal tank I intend as a QT
